Poiana Brașov
Romania's largest resort in the Carpathians outside Brașov: affordable, traditional, and family friendly.

Location
Set in the Carpathian Mountains of central Romania, the resort sits on the slopes of the Postăvarul massif just above the city of Brașov. The terrain is mid-mountain and forested, with a continental interior climate and cold, snowy winters.
Getting there
Easy to reach
Fly into Brașov (GHV), about 35 minutes from the resort by road.
